Sarah Palin's defamation lawsuit against the New York Times will go to trial in Manhattan on Feb. 1, according to reports.
The Times piece was edited and corrected the day after it was published to clarify there was no known link between the shooter and Palin’s ad.
Public figures have a higher burden of proof in defamation cases, but in 2020, Manhattan District Court Judge Jed S. Rakoff said there was "sufficient evidence to allow a rational finder of fact to find actual malice by clear and convincing evidence" and said the lawsuit could go to trial. Rakoff had initially dismissed the claim before an appeal, according to the Hollywood Reporter.
